In command relationships, what does Assigned mean?

Explanation:
Assigned means a unit is brought into an organization as a relatively permanent element under that command, becoming part of its structure. This status ties the unit to the organization’s ongoing mission and implies shared administration and logistics as an integrated part of the force, not something kept there only for a short-term purpose. In contrast, a unit that is temporarily placed in an organization is described as attached, which indicates a short, purpose-driven relationship while still remaining administratively separate.
